突破流媒体下载瓶颈:N_m3u8DL-RE的全场景应用指南
支持多协议/跨平台/自定义配置的流媒体解决方案
在数字化内容爆炸的今天,流媒体已成为信息传播的主要载体。然而,用户在获取流媒体内容时常常面临三大痛点:直播录制过程中频繁中断导致内容残缺、多轨道视频下载后合并困难造成观看体验下降、遇到加密内容时解析失败无法获取资源。N_m3u8DL-RE作为一款跨平台、现代且功能强大的流媒体下载器,专为解决这些问题而生,支持MPD/M3U8/ISM格式,提供英语、简体中文和繁体中文界面,为用户带来高效、稳定的流媒体下载体验。
价值定位:重新定义流媒体下载体验
N_m3u8DL-RE以其卓越的性能和丰富的功能,重新定义了流媒体下载的标准。它不仅能够稳定可靠地下载各类流媒体内容,还能根据用户需求进行高度自定义配置,满足不同场景下的下载需求。无论是直播录制、多轨道视频获取还是加密内容解析,N_m3u8DL-RE都能提供一站式解决方案,让用户轻松应对流媒体下载过程中的各种挑战。
核心能力:三大创新点驱动高效下载
1. 智能直播录制技术
传统方案在直播录制时,往往因网络波动或服务器限制导致录制中断,且中断后难以恢复,造成内容丢失。N_m3u8DL-RE采用智能断点续传和动态调整策略,能够实时监测网络状态,在网络恢复后自动继续录制,确保直播内容的完整性。同时,其先进的缓存机制可以有效减少因网络波动带来的影响,保证录制过程的稳定性。
2. 多轨道自动合并技术
传统工具在下载多轨道视频后,需要用户手动进行轨道合并,操作复杂且容易出错。N_m3u8DL-RE内置多轨道识别和自动合并功能,能够根据视频的元数据信息,自动识别音轨、字幕轨等不同轨道,并按照用户设定的优先级进行合并,生成完整的视频文件,大大简化了用户的操作流程。
3. 高效加密内容解析技术
面对加密的流媒体内容,传统方案往往束手无策或解析效率低下。N_m3u8DL-RE支持多种加密算法的解析,包括常见的AES加密等(需确保拥有合法访问权限),通过优化的解密算法和并行处理技术,能够快速高效地解析加密内容,在保证安全性的同时,不影响下载速度。
场景实践:三大领域的具体应用案例
内容创作领域
内容创作者常常需要下载高清视频素材进行编辑和再创作。使用N_m3u8DL-RE,创作者可以通过简单的命令行参数设置,下载所需的视频内容。例如,要下载一个HLS协议(基于HTTP的流媒体传输技术)的视频,并指定保存名称和输出格式,只需在命令行中输入相应的指令,工具便会自动完成下载和处理过程,为创作者节省大量时间和精力。
教育学习领域
学生和教育工作者在学习过程中,可能需要下载在线课程视频进行离线观看。N_m3u8DL-RE支持多种流媒体协议,能够下载来自不同教育平台的课程视频。用户可以根据自己的需求,选择合适的视频质量和格式,确保离线学习的效果。同时,工具的多轨道合并功能可以将课程视频中的字幕轨一并下载并合并,方便学习过程中查看字幕。
技术研究领域
对于流媒体技术的研究者来说,N_m3u8DL-RE是一个强大的研究工具。通过分析工具的源代码和工作原理,研究者可以深入了解流媒体协议的实现细节和加密机制。例如,查看N_m3u8DL-RE.Parser/Extractor/HLSExtractor.cs文件,可以了解HLS协议的解析过程;研究N_m3u8DL-RE/Crypto/AESUtil.cs文件,可以掌握AES加密算法在流媒体中的应用。
进阶探索:深入了解工具的高级功能
N_m3u8DL-RE提供了丰富的高级功能,用户可以通过定制命令行参数来实现个性化的下载需求。例如,设置下载线程数可以提高下载速度,调整重试次数可以增强下载的稳定性,自动选择最佳轨道可以确保下载的视频质量。此外,工具还支持对下载的视频进行后期处理,如格式转换、剪辑等,进一步拓展了其应用范围。
📌 快速上手三步骤
- 克隆仓库:使用命令
git clone https://gitcode.com/GitHub_Trending/nm3/N_m3u8DL-RE获取项目代码。 - 编译项目:根据项目中的编译说明,完成工具的编译过程。
- 运行工具:在命令行中输入相应的指令,开始流媒体下载。
⚠️ 重要提示:在使用N_m3u8DL-RE时,请确保遵守相关法律法规和版权规定,尊重内容创作者的权益。支持加密内容下载(需确保拥有合法访问权限)。
常见问题速查表
| 问题 | 解决方案 |
|---|---|
| 下载速度慢 | 尝试增加下载线程数,或检查网络连接是否稳定 |
| 无法解析加密内容 | 确认是否拥有合法访问权限,或检查加密算法是否被工具支持 |
| 多轨道合并失败 | 检查视频的元数据信息是否完整,或尝试更新工具到最新版本 |
资源链接区
- 官方文档:docs/official.md
- 安装包下载:releases/
- 社区支持:community/
- 开发者赞助:sponsor/
通过以上内容,相信您对N_m3u8DL-RE有了全面的了解。无论您是内容创作者、教育学习爱好者还是技术研究者,N_m3u8DL-RE都能为您提供强大的流媒体下载支持,助您轻松获取所需的流媒体内容。
GLM-5智谱 AI 正式发布 GLM-5,旨在应对复杂系统工程和长时域智能体任务。Jinja00
GLM-5-w4a8GLM-5-w4a8基于混合专家架构,专为复杂系统工程与长周期智能体任务设计。支持单/多节点部署,适配Atlas 800T A3,采用w4a8量化技术,结合vLLM推理优化,高效平衡性能与精度,助力智能应用开发Jinja00
jiuwenclawJiuwenClaw 是一款基于openJiuwen开发的智能AI Agent,它能够将大语言模型的强大能力,通过你日常使用的各类通讯应用,直接延伸至你的指尖。Python0220- QQwen3.5-397B-A17BQwen3.5 实现了重大飞跃,整合了多模态学习、架构效率、强化学习规模以及全球可访问性等方面的突破性进展,旨在为开发者和企业赋予前所未有的能力与效率。Jinja00
AtomGit城市坐标计划AtomGit 城市坐标计划开启!让开源有坐标,让城市有星火。致力于与城市合伙人共同构建并长期运营一个健康、活跃的本地开发者生态。01
AntSK基于.Net9 + AntBlazor + SemanticKernel 和KernelMemory 打造的AI知识库/智能体,支持本地离线AI大模型。可以不联网离线运行。支持aspire观测应用数据CSS01
